|
Как уменьшить потребление UART, по умолчанию у UART лог0 =5В |
|
|
|
Oct 7 2008, 22:25
|
Частый гость
 
Группа: Новичок
Сообщений: 97
Регистрация: 15-04-08
Пользователь №: 36 783

|
У меня для перелачи данных UART c M8 используется оптопара. и получается что этот лог.0 - 5В на выходе TXD дают потребление 20ма постоянно ( что можно сделать? Всем УМНЫМ ГОЛОВАМ сюда!!!))) а то дудеть устаю
Сообщение отредактировал Electronic) - Oct 7 2008, 22:30
--------------------
Самурай без меча - такой же, как самурай с мечом, только без меча
|
|
|
|
3 страниц
1 2 3 >
|
 |
Ответов
(1 - 37)
|
Oct 8 2008, 08:55
|
Частый гость
 
Группа: Новичок
Сообщений: 97
Регистрация: 15-04-08
Пользователь №: 36 783

|
Цитата(defunct @ Oct 8 2008, 01:34)  включать 0-м и инвертировать сигнал после оптопары. А если не для ГУРУ?) что бы ещё и понять можно было
--------------------
Самурай без меча - такой же, как самурай с мечом, только без меча
|
|
|
|
|
Oct 8 2008, 09:45
|
Частый гость
 
Группа: Новичок
Сообщений: 97
Регистрация: 15-04-08
Пользователь №: 36 783

|
ЛЮДИ ПРОЧИТАЙТЕ ВОПРОС!!! КАК ИНВЕРТИРОВАТЬ ВЫХОД TXD МК М8!??? что бы у него логический ноль стал 0В а не 5В!? транзистор ставить не хочется придётся перезаказывать платы
--------------------
Самурай без меча - такой же, как самурай с мечом, только без меча
|
|
|
|
|
Oct 8 2008, 09:54
|
Местный
  
Группа: Свой
Сообщений: 437
Регистрация: 23-04-05
Из: Таганрог
Пользователь №: 4 425

|
Цитата(Electronic) @ Oct 8 2008, 13:45)  ЛЮДИ ПРОЧИТАЙТЕ ВОПРОС!!! КАК ИНВЕРТИРОВАТЬ ВЫХОД TXD МК М8!??? что бы у него логический ноль стал 0В а не 5В!? транзистор ставить не хочется придётся перезаказывать платы Первый рисунок - как скорее всего сделано у вас Второй - как надо сделать
Эскизы прикрепленных изображений
|
|
|
|
|
Oct 8 2008, 10:53
|
Частый гость
 
Группа: Новичок
Сообщений: 97
Регистрация: 15-04-08
Пользователь №: 36 783

|
Dopler Вы правы но у меня на проводе только +12 есть. наверное поставлю стабилитрон... просто напряжение это прыгает +7 / +13В ... может быть подскажите схемотехнику для такого варианта напряжения? самые вероятные изменения напряжения 7,5-10В вобщем поставлю что то в стиле... кт3102  только смд, может поскажете модель? такую что б пошустрее, смд, красиво открывался и закрыватся и стоил 20-30коп. я ведь смд транзистор в первый раз покупать буду.
Сообщение отредактировал Electronic) - Oct 8 2008, 11:30
--------------------
Самурай без меча - такой же, как самурай с мечом, только без меча
|
|
|
|
|
Oct 8 2008, 11:02
|
Местный
  
Группа: Свой
Сообщений: 437
Регистрация: 23-04-05
Из: Таганрог
Пользователь №: 4 425

|
Цитата(Electronic) @ Oct 8 2008, 14:53)  Dopler Вы правы но у меня на проводе только +12 есть. наверное поставлю стабилитрон... просто напряжение это прыгает +7 / +13В ... может быть подскажите схемотехнику для такого варианта напряжения?
самые вероятные изменения напряжения 7,5-10В А контроллер у вас тоже от такого попрыгунчика питается?
|
|
|
|
|
Oct 8 2008, 11:33
|
Частый гость
 
Группа: Новичок
Сообщений: 97
Регистрация: 15-04-08
Пользователь №: 36 783

|
Цитата(Dopler @ Oct 8 2008, 14:02)  А контроллер у вас тоже от такого попрыгунчика питается? там кренка... но на провод СОМ компорта идёт 0, txd, rtd, + 7 - +12В ... во так...буду платы переделывать(
--------------------
Самурай без меча - такой же, как самурай с мечом, только без меча
|
|
|
|
|
Oct 8 2008, 11:42
|
Местный
  
Группа: Свой
Сообщений: 437
Регистрация: 23-04-05
Из: Таганрог
Пользователь №: 4 425

|
Цитата(Electronic) @ Oct 8 2008, 15:33)  там кренка... но на провод СОМ компорта идёт 0, txd, rtd, + 7 - +12В ... во так...буду платы переделывать( Подозреваю, если вы не покажете свое творчество общественности, "платы переделывать" придется не один раз.
|
|
|
|
|
Oct 8 2008, 15:45
|
Частый гость
 
Группа: Новичок
Сообщений: 97
Регистрация: 15-04-08
Пользователь №: 36 783

|
Цитата(Pyku_He_oTTyda @ Oct 8 2008, 17:22)  Поток непрерывный? Если нет, то почему не отключить УАРТ при простое а ничего что приёмник COM порта будет фиксировать это станет искать старт бит....
--------------------
Самурай без меча - такой же, как самурай с мечом, только без меча
|
|
|
|
|
Oct 8 2008, 19:34
|
Местный
  
Группа: Свой
Сообщений: 437
Регистрация: 23-04-05
Из: Таганрог
Пользователь №: 4 425

|
Цитата(Electronic) @ Oct 8 2008, 23:19)  я ж сказал транзистор поставлю это то и пугает
|
|
|
|
|
Oct 8 2008, 19:54
|
Частый гость
 
Группа: Новичок
Сообщений: 97
Регистрация: 15-04-08
Пользователь №: 36 783

|
Цитата(Dopler @ Oct 8 2008, 22:34)  это то и пугает Уважаемый ну не получается так как Вы советуете я же писал (0,txd,rxd,+U)... было б у меня место в разьёме я бы поставил туда кренку на 0,1А и всё. или какие у вас предложения?
--------------------
Самурай без меча - такой же, как самурай с мечом, только без меча
|
|
|
|
|
Oct 8 2008, 20:00
|
Частый гость
 
Группа: Новичок
Сообщений: 97
Регистрация: 15-04-08
Пользователь №: 36 783

|
так подскажите как обойтись безних? или для чего вы пишете я не пойму....
--------------------
Самурай без меча - такой же, как самурай с мечом, только без меча
|
|
|
|
|
Oct 8 2008, 20:33
|

Чайник, 1 литр
   
Группа: Свой
Сообщений: 655
Регистрация: 17-05-06
Из: Moscow
Пользователь №: 17 168

|
Цитата(Electronic) @ Oct 9 2008, 00:00)  так подскажите как обойтись безних? или для чего вы пишете я не пойму.... Только: Цитата(Pyku_He_oTTyda @ Oct 8 2008, 18:22)  Поток непрерывный? Если нет, то почему не отключить УАРТ при простое ...и выставить на ноге TXD принудительно ноль. Цитата(Electronic) @ Oct 8 2008, 19:45)  а ничего что приёмник COM порта будет фиксировать это станет искать старт бит.... А протоколы обмена правильные и обработку данных с ошибками фрейма надо использовать, тогда это пофигу.
|
|
|
|
|
Oct 8 2008, 20:48
|
Частый гость
 
Группа: Новичок
Сообщений: 97
Регистрация: 15-04-08
Пользователь №: 36 783

|
SysRq спасибо что не нарыкал на меня )) Ну вобще конечно поток плотный... я не дятел)  если бы UART работал раз в году я бы его тушил и никого не спрашивал... там паузы 0,2 - 0,5Сек между символами... Я думал может всё таки разработчики что то предусматрели. поставлю транзистор инвертирющий да и всё, спаибо всем кто принимал участие  я так понял что чудес не бывает хотя и ждал очень)))
Сообщение отредактировал Electronic) - Oct 8 2008, 20:51
--------------------
Самурай без меча - такой же, как самурай с мечом, только без меча
|
|
|
|
|
Oct 9 2008, 05:41
|
Местный
  
Группа: Свой
Сообщений: 437
Регистрация: 23-04-05
Из: Таганрог
Пользователь №: 4 425

|
Цитата(Electronic) @ Oct 8 2008, 23:54)  Уважаемый ну не получается так как Вы советуете я же писал (0,txd,rxd,+U)... было б у меня место в разьёме я бы поставил туда кренку на 0,1А и всё. или какие у вас предложения? На этом форуме много опытных людей, которые подскажут вам за 15 минут. Дело в том, что в ваших скачущих мыслях трудно уловить рациональное зерно. Я ни асилил что такое "(0,txd,rxd,+U)", а много думать на эту тему лень. Так что схему в студию, других вариантов вам помочь я не вижу. P.S. тот магический smd тарнзистор, который вы хотите, называется bc817.
|
|
|
|
|
Oct 9 2008, 08:00
|
Частый гость
 
Группа: Новичок
Сообщений: 97
Регистрация: 15-04-08
Пользователь №: 36 783

|
Я всего лишь спорсил как инвертировать сигнал на выходе UART. если никак то всё, тема закрыта. Если я выложу устройство, 10 паралельных грвфиков и алгоритмы их взаимодействия, я так понял что вы тоже не разберётесь, и ломать голову тоже не будете)) если даже не понятна такая простая истина что нет у меня +5В на шнурке СОМ порта, есть только не стабилизированое зависящие от нагрузки и напряжения в сети.
"P.S. тот магический smd тарнзистор, который вы хотите, называется bc817." спасибо что ответили по теме, очень благодарен!
Прошу отвечать только по созданым темам и вопросам. СПАСИБО всем кто учтёт!
Сообщение отредактировал Electronic) - Oct 9 2008, 08:42
--------------------
Самурай без меча - такой же, как самурай с мечом, только без меча
|
|
|
|
|
Oct 9 2008, 08:13
|

Гуру
     
Группа: Модераторы
Сообщений: 8 455
Регистрация: 15-05-06
Из: Рига, Латвия
Пользователь №: 17 095

|
Цитата(Electronic) @ Oct 9 2008, 11:00)  Я всего лишь спорсил как инвертировать сигнал на выходе UART. Схема, приведенная в посте №8 как раз и инвертирует сигнал на светодиоде, что вам и нужно было. Если вы не в состоянии понять, что 5 - 0 = 5, а 5 - 5 = 0, то разжевывать вам это дальше навряд-ли кто-нибудь захочет. Покупайте свой первый транзистор. Цитата(Electronic) @ Oct 9 2008, 11:00)  Прошу отвечать только по созданым темам и вопросам. СПАСИБО всем кто учтёт! Как жаль, что нельзя попросить понимать, что все ответы в этой ветке были именно на заданный вопрос. Увы
--------------------
На любой вопрос даю любой ответ"Write code that is guaranteed to work, not code that doesn’t seem to break" ( C++ FAQ)
|
|
|
|
|
Oct 9 2008, 09:53
|
Частый гость
 
Группа: Новичок
Сообщений: 97
Регистрация: 15-04-08
Пользователь №: 36 783

|
"Схема, приведенная в посте №8 как раз и инвертирует сигнал на светодиоде, что вам и нужно было. Если вы не в состоянии понять, что 5 - 0 = 5, а 5 - 5 = 0, то разжевывать вам это дальше навряд-ли кто-нибудь захочет. Покупайте свой первый транзистор" мдя... наверное я просто понимал это намного раньше Вас  ... и потому решил создать тему... как Вам такой оборот? у меня нет +5  есть +7 - +10! неужели это так тяжело осознать? неужели не понятно что если я прицеплю + диода на + 7 - +12 а -диода на ножку мк, то он не будет тухнуть а только будет изменятся яркость, так как на минусе у него будет прыгать 0 - +5 в такт с сигналом... ну просто диву даюсь)))
--------------------
Самурай без меча - такой же, как самурай с мечом, только без меча
|
|
|
|
|
Oct 9 2008, 10:21
|

Гуру
     
Группа: Модераторы
Сообщений: 8 455
Регистрация: 15-05-06
Из: Рига, Латвия
Пользователь №: 17 095

|
Цитата(Electronic) @ Oct 9 2008, 12:53)  у меня нет +5  есть +7 - +10! Повторяю вопрос rezidenta, который задавал в предыдущем сообщении: Цитата(Сергей Борщ @ Oct 9 2008, 03:12)  Сейчас, когда у вас светодиод зажжен в паузах, откуда на него поступает напряжение? С процессора? А на процессор оно откуда поступает? Если и сейчас ответом на этот вопрос будет молчание, то больше я не буду пытаться вам помогать - поставлю на вас игнор.
--------------------
На любой вопрос даю любой ответ"Write code that is guaranteed to work, not code that doesn’t seem to break" ( C++ FAQ)
|
|
|
|
|
Oct 9 2008, 11:19
|
Местный
  
Группа: Свой
Сообщений: 426
Регистрация: 5-04-07
Из: Санкт-Петербург
Пользователь №: 26 782

|
Я что-то не пойму. Мне кажется, что знакомство с первым в жизни коллеги SMD транзистором можно отложить. Речь идет об TXD, если я правильно понял. 1-ый вариант - если девайс мастер. Пака не надо передавать TXD на вход, TXEN=0. Когда нужна передача - как обычно, 2-ой вариант - слэйв, пока не начался запрос от мастера TXEN=0, TXD на вход или в ноль. Надо отвечать взвел TXEN =1 ответил, опять залег.
Транзистор даже SMD не спасет, ну проинвертирует он TXD, а как дальше с условием старта стопа паритета, если он есть. Значит второй транзистор для второй инверсии или пинцет, скальпель... огурец.
Вообще то прав Сергей Борщ и многие откликнувшиеся, кроме напора "Поможите!", ничего автор пока не выложил.
|
|
|
|
|
Oct 9 2008, 11:44
|
Частый гость
 
Группа: Новичок
Сообщений: 97
Регистрация: 15-04-08
Пользователь №: 36 783

|
я писал что на плате мк стоит кренка... и помоему это и ежу понятно. у меня устроуство такое что то что вы пишете не возможно. рисовать не буду потому что тема не о том как переделать устройство. помогать мне я говорил где надо. только один человек ответил по теме и сказал что это никак не сделать. я перекинул провода на шнурке ком порта (точнее на оптопаре) , и поставил транзистор. всё работает. Спасибо всем кто помогал и хотел помочь!
Капец... напишу в двух словах есть устровйство у него блок питания. на БП 3 разьёма. 2 проводами подключаются к двум платам на каждой по мк. а в 3-й разьём с шнурком для коп порта. все 3 разьёма запаралелены и на них меются : земля, txd,rdx, +U не стаб. привыкайте отвечать на вопросы а не разводить филосифию, то что я не спросил то я уже себе посоветовал
Сообщение отредактировал Electronic) - Oct 9 2008, 12:01
--------------------
Самурай без меча - такой же, как самурай с мечом, только без меча
|
|
|
|
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0
|
|
|